Ktm North America, Inc.
NHTSA Campaign: 21V304000 SAFETY RECALL
3.7K Vehicles Affected
Recall Date: Apr 30, 2021
Safety Issue:

KTM North America, Inc. (KTM) is recalling certain 2019-2020 KTM 790 Adventure and 790 Adventure R, and 2020 KTM 790 Adventure R Rally motorcycles. The front brake master cylinder piston return spring may be too weak to return the brake piston to its original position, reducing the functionality of the front brake.

Potential Risk:
A front brake with reduced functionality may increase the distance required to stop as well as the risk of a crash or injury.
FREE Recall Solution:
Dealers will replace the return spring,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ed May 21, 2021. Owners may contact KTM customer service at 1-888-985-6090. KTM's number for this recall is KTM2106.
